How to Resize ODG Files Using C#

Constructing a website is a complex endeavor where each element holds significance. A crucial aspect in the process of populating web pages revolves around resizing images. Often, the need arises to resize their dimensions and prepare images or photos in varying resolutions. For instance, pages featuring image galleries with previews require small thumbnail files, while pages showcasing main images demand high-resolution versions. For larger files, resizing is essential to reduce total pixel count, thus diminishing file size without significantly compromising image quality. During image resizing, you can also choose the degree of data compression to strike a balance between image size and quality. Reduced image sizes lead to quicker loading times from the internet, enhancing the user browsing experience on your website.     ODG What is ODG File Format

    The ODG file format is used by Apache OpenOffice's Draw application to store drawing elements as a vector image. It follows the XML based file format specifications outlined by Advancement of Structural Information Standards (OASIS). ODG represents drawings as vector images using points, lines and curves. Besides OpenOffice, LibreOffice and other applications also provide support for working with ODG file format. Other formats supported by OpenOffice, for example, include ODT, ODF, ODP and ODS.
